About 10% of the world’s earthquakes of magnitude 6 or higher occur in or around Japan, so the risk is much higher than in places like Europe or the eastern United States, where earthquakes are rare

 The Nankai Trough is actually a 700-kilometer lengthy (435-mile) subduction area, which pertains to when tectonic layers lapse underneath one another. A lot of the world's quakes and also tsunamis are actually created due to the activities of tectonic layers - and also the best highly effective typically take place in subduction areas.

Within this particular instance, the tectonic plate under the Philippine Ocean is actually gradually slipping up underneath the continental plate where Japan lies, relocating numerous centimeters annually, inning accordance with a 2013 file due to the government's Quake Study Board.


At the Nankai Trough, extreme quakes have actually been actually videotaped every one hundred towards 200 years, inning accordance with the board. The final such quakes happened in 1944 and also 1946, each gauging 8.1 in magnitude; they ruined Japan, along with at the very least 2,five hundred complete fatalities and also manies thousand even more harmed, along with 10s of hundreds of residences damaged.

Through computing the periods in between each primary quake, the Japanese federal authorities has actually alerted there's a 70% towards 80% opportunity that Japan will definitely be actually rocked through an additional Nankai Trough quake within three decade, counted on to become in between size 8 and also 9.

Yet these forecasts, and also the energy of also producing lasting imprecise forecasts, have actually encountered sturdy pushback coming from some one-fourths.


Yoshioka, coming from Kobe Educational institution, claimed the 70%-80% amount was actually very likely expensive, and also the records attracted coming from one certain idea, producing it likely even more vulnerable towards mistakes. Nonetheless, he possessed certainly that "a primary quake will definitely take place around" down the road.


"I say to (my students), the Nankai Trough quake will definitely absolutely happened, whether it is your age or even your children's age," he claimed.


Robert Geller, a seismologist and also lecturer emeritus at the Educational institution of Tokyo, was actually even more doubtful, phoning the Nankai Trough quake a "made-up create" and also a "totally theoretical circumstance."


He additionally said that quakes do not take place in cycles, yet may happen at any kind of area and also opportunity - definition there is little bit of aspect computing when the upcoming quake will definitely happened based upon when previous ones have actually took place.


It is a factor of opinion in the medical community; seismologists have actually lengthy counted on the suggestion that anxiety collects gradually along a mistake in between pair of tectonic layers, at that point is actually unexpectedly discharged in quakes, a pattern called the "stick-slip" method - however even more latest research researches have actually presented that is certainly not consistently the instance.
